Transaction 0751c1064d921175f229346169c8504ec18290071a74169018b35b88bbdf94eb

7 Input
2 Outputs
  • 0751c1064d921175f229346169c8504ec18290071a74169018b35b88bbdf94eb:0
  • value  1012015
    address  1AQmfmZn5rAwe8ax1wsffQyKkMSEYUsVtX
  • 0751c1064d921175f229346169c8504ec18290071a74169018b35b88bbdf94eb:1
  • value  22216238
    address  3GEtqEeWiC1wMpE5AHi5j1Xdqpv3ushN9B